* Consider this three-digit sequence: 943. Is the first digit the largest or the second digit the smallest, AND, is the third digit even or the first digit odd?

1 Answer

2 votes
(pVq)∧(rVs)
p is the first digit largest
q is the second digit is smallest
r is the third digit is even
s is the first is odd therefore (pVq) = (TVF) = T
(rVs) = (FVT) = T
so the statement becomes T∧T = T
the statement is True
